Problem:  Getting toc entries to HyperLink to its relevant page number.

History:
Version 2.3 this worked fine; it worked from the git-go.

Version 2.4:  Does not create links in the toc to the relevant page 
numbers.  Else format is correct, everything else is right.

Repair Attempts:
--  Repair Install; no help
--  Uninstalled/reinstalled; no help.

Currently attempting:
   To use the Help instructions to implement creating links for the TOC 
entries.  No matter what I do, I lose part of the toc; either the text 
or the page numbers, and never do get any hyperlinks in the TOC.

a Detailed What I do:

-- Open a Word .doc document.
   The source doesn't matter. These same things happen with an original, 
natively created .odt document.
-- Save it back to disk as an .odt as would be expected.
-- Headings are used to create the TOC.  Heading levels 1 thru 6.  This 
particular doc is around 100 pages but document size seems to be 
irrelevant.

--  Click Insert | Indexes and Tables | Indexes and Tables
--  Preview of resulting dialong looks fine; shows a proper toc, but ... 
shows it as not having links.  By comparing to an older 2.3 created 
document, in version 2.4, it appears I will see the link colors in the 
Preview window here if they are turned on.  Those documents show that, 
new documents in 2.4 do not because there are no links to show.
--  Help says to:
  --  Click the Entries tab.
  --  Click in the structure area, "behind the E," and click Hyperlink. 
Huh?  BEHIND the E?  What does that MEAN?  There IS an E (for Entry) 
there, and clicking it highlights it.  Its meaning then changes to the 
beginning of the Hyperlink, or Hyperlink start.  OK, maybe it's partly 
accomplished.
 --  Then it says to Click E, then click Hyperlink but when I do, 
"Headingxx" disappears from the Preview.  ??  The Preview is now just 
"........ ... .  And if I click OK here, that "..." is exactly what I'll 
get for the TOC entries!
--  Then it says to click in the "box behind the E", and click Hyperlink 
again.  HUH?  BEHIND the E?  Again?  WHAT does that MEAN??  Since now, 
no E is showing, and I have no idea what "behind the E" can mean, I'm 
lost!
   The box choices now are E#, LS, T and #; nothing else.  As a result, 
there is nothing for me to click for the "end" of the hyperlink, now 
that I have the "start" of it identified!

NOW, if I ignore the instructions, why not they aren't valid, and 
instead click on Hyperlink first, THEN it'll expose an LE, or hyperlink 
END, but ... it destroys the TOC again!

The actions of the boxes, etc. are the same whether it's during creation 
of a TOC or I create the toc first, sans links, and then choose to Edit 
it from the context menu.
